On the front of the engine on the passenger side where the head meets the engine block there will be a machined surface (called the pad) that contains the last 5 or 6 digits of your VIN AND also another (separate) number that denotes where the engine was made (starts with a V for flint Michigan or a T for Tonawanda), numbers that denote the build date of the motor, and a suffix that tells the options that came with the motor.
Mine reads V327HP which denotes a small block engine built in Flint Michigan on March 27 and HP are the initials for the L&( 350 horsepower motor with Power Brakes, Power steering and A/C.
If you find the numbers, many on this forum have the books to decipher them for you and will be glad to help.
